Endless Night Time Sky

Starting with Goodbye

Gerard's pov.
The hall we entered was huge. Really huge. And was full of people. Sleepy looking teens passed me, many of them in pajamas. It took me a moment to realize that these teens were nocturnal, and that their classes probably began sometime around now. They looked almost like normal teens, only small things hinting that they were… unnatural. I saw a lot of sharp teeth, and many strange eye colors. A few were flying, like, actually flying, though they looked like they were half asleep and kept bumping into things. Some had colorful (and very messy) hair, and they looked like they were from all around the world. None of them offered my family a second glance, so I guessed that newcomers weren't that strange.
A huge staircase led up to the upper floors. The staircase and railings was decorated with the same pretty engravings as the oak door that closed behind me. All of it was stunning, though I hated to admit it. I was supposed to be sad and angry and scared, and I still was, but the look of this castle made me a little less sad and angry and scared. Yeah, Mikes had been right; it would be cool to live here.

-Welcome to the Academy, Mr. Way, the woman with the warm golden eyes laid a hand on my shoulder. I looked up at her. - I am Kenzie, by the way. She smiled again. This Kenzie smiled a lot really. I liked it. And her eyes fit her dark complexion. And she smelled weird. Like grass and... dog, actually. It made me feel a little better, and I did give her a small smile, though it was forced. She patted my back and guided me forward through the mass of sleepy teenagers and taking me to an office, my family shuffling after me. Mikey was looking wide-eyed at the teenagers, obviously trying to figure out what species they were. My parents, on the other hand, walked stiffly and kept their eyes glued to the wooden floor, trying to disappear.
The office was old fashioned, like the rest of the castle, 16th century gothic style. It smelled of parchment and wood, huge bookshelves covering the walls. A grand desk stood in the middle of the room, snirkling engravings covering the legs, which ended in lion’s feet. It was pretty impressive, but I couldn't not think how fucking heavy it must have been to carry, and how the hell they got it through that door.
A man sat behind the desk, in a big comfortable chair. He looked about forty, black stubble covering his chin. His dark brown eyes crinkled at his kind smile, though he looked like a serious and neat man. He gestured for us to sit down in the chairs in front of the desk. I did, and found the chairs surprisingly soft. Kenzie came after us and sat beside the man.
He cleared his throat.
-Welcome, Mr. Way, to Oswald’s Academy for Talented Youngsters. His voice was deep and strict. – My name is Jasper Cornelius Oswald, the founder and headmaster of this Academy. I hope you did not have too many difficulties finding your way up here. You know, we have had some situations where the former issue has been a problem.
-N-no, my dad collected himself, - That has not been a problem; it was easy finding our way with the coordinates you sent us. That was not entirely true; mom had taken a few wrong turns.
-Good, the headmaster gave him a nod. He turned his attention to me again. I tried to not look scared. I probably had to answer a lot of questions. – You were bitten September 12th, right, 13 days ago? Wow, way to be straightforward. He gave me a reassuring smile, and I nodded. – This means that you are still in the turning process, Mr. Way, and you probably have experienced some changes already. I nodded again. – And you will experience a lot more in the near future. The process takes about a month from when you are bitten and until you are fully vampire. Could you tell us what's already changed about you?
Fuck, I had to talk.
-Um, yeah, I um- Kenzie leaned forward, interrupting me.
-This is just because we need to know what stage you are on, keep track on what’s left and how fast this is happening.
-Oh, yeah, well... (What the hell was I, some kind of experiment?) – First came the, um... teeth... I stuttered. I remembered running my tongue over them and feeling my sharp canines for the first time, strange and huge, poking my bottom lip. – And the, you know, need for, um, blood, I almost whispered, drawing a sharp breath and not daring to look at my parents. I could feel them stiffen beside me. Kenzie just nodded like this was the most normal thing in the world, her smile encouraging me to continue while she scribbled it down. I did. - Then... I paused. Then, the nightmares began, the hunger, the frustration, pain, anger, depression, and the trauma. I gathered myself, trying not to think about it. – Then, things started to happen gradually, you know, I was less tired in the night, started to sleep longer in the day. The sun became more and more annoying, like I got sunburn from walking to the library and back. And, um, I don’t feel much temperature anymore. It’s like, I’m not cold, not warm, but objects still have temperature, it feels really weird. I gave Kenzie a questioning look.
-Yes, said Kenzie, nodding, - Your own body doesn't absorb the heat anymore, so you can feel the temperature of the object or person, but your own body repels it. This, for example, also means that you can wear whatever you want without being too cold or too hot. Which is really practical. I nodded. Finally something I could take advantage of. I was so tired of feeling like a boiled egg trough the whole fucking summer.
-Is there anything more? Mr. Oswald sounded strange and loud in comparison to Kenzie’s soft voice. I shook my head.
-No, um, I don’t think so...
-Well, you seem to be on schedule. Kenzie gave me a nod of approval. – Let’s see... Oh, yeah, as you probably saw, the students here can be quite different from one another. There are vampires, like yourself, werewolves, like myself (that explained the slight dog smell), and warlocks, like Mr. Oswald here. And yes, as you saw, their classes are at night, as all of the three species here have a nocturnal body clock. She checked her wristwatch. - They should be finished with breakfast about now. Also, here is your schedule and list of classes. She found a paper sheet, and handed it to me across the desk. I looked at it. I quickly scanned the list of topics, and to my relief, there was no math. I looked at the list again. It read:
-Supernatural History through the Ages (everyone). Great, I though. History. Yay.
-The Art of Attack (everyone)
-The Art of Defense (everyone). Both attack and defense? Was shit really that dangerous? I continued on.
-The Moon and its Effects (everyone). Oh, yeah, I was going to turn into some blood sucking monster in about a week or something. Nice.
-Physical Education (everyone). Fuck. I still had to do P.E.
-Warlocks, Werewolves and Vampires (everyone)
-Warlocks, Werewolves or Vampires (dependent on species). Seriously? And Vampires, or Vampires. I looked questioning at Kenzie. – They couldn't decide, or what? She laughed, clearly knowing what I was talking about.
-No no, there is one class where you learn about all the three species and one where you elaborate in your own species, getting to know your abilities better.
-Oh, okay, I mumbled, feeling stupid. I should have guessed that. – And, I looked at the list again, - Special Ability Training? What special ability are they talking about?
-Ah, yeah, after a while, you will begin to develop a special power, so you will, when you have found this power, train at using it together with the other students in your year.
This sounded more and more like X-Men. Kenzie continued talking. – There is also the class of choice, and the information we received said that you wanted art, is that right? I nodded. Of course I chose art. It was about the only topic I was interested in. – And Mr. Way, don’t worry, the school year has just begun, so you haven’t missed out on anything much. Well that was good to hear. As if I cared a lot. She continued. – And you wanted a single room? I nodded again. It wasn't as if I knew someone here who I wanted to share with. – Great, she smiled. – Everything seems in order. Remember that if you want roommates, change in roommates, or another room, just come talk to me and we will fix it for you. I smiled. That seemed about it. But Mr. Oswald cleared his throat once again.
-I think you are forgetting something important, Kenzie. He smiled cunningly. – The boy is a vampire, and he needs blood. My body stiffened, the thought nauseating me, though my mouth watered. Traitorous mouth. – We have sufficient stocks of blood, which Kenzie will show you later today. But I was just wondering, what have you been drinking the last two weeks? Bloodlust is the first change you notice, and you couldn't have gone two weeks without blood. I swallowed, getting ready to speak and looked over at Mikey.
-I have, um, been drinking animal blood. I shuddered. It was so gross, I thought, but it also tasted so amazing. – It was actually my brother’s idea, he came up with the thought. And it seemed to work. But, my eyes are black, though... I pointed to my eyes. – Is that, uh, normal? I asked. I didn't like it at all, to be honest.
-Oh, yeah, when drinking animal blood, your eyes turn black, Kenzie said. – It’s strange. When you drink the blood we have here, your eyes will return to their natural color after a little while. But, animal blood, what a clever young man. She smiled widely at Mikey, her teeth showing. He beamed back at her, clearly proud. – Remember that animal blood is not entirely healthy for you, though, but it is a clever replacement for human blood when you don’t have that for hand. She stood up, smiling. – Well, that seems about it, should we, um, say goodbye? She clapped her hands.
Fuck. I wouldn't see Mikes in a long time, several months actually. I stood up, looking at my family. Giving my parents quick hugs (they weren't too happy about having to touch a vampire), I turned towards Mikey. Not caring about Kenzie or the headmaster, I threw my arms around my brother in a big hug, burying myself in his neck, smelling his citrusy shampoo for the last time in a long while.
-Call me, right? he whispered, hugging me back.
-Every fucking day, I whispered back. – Come visit me here, okay?
-Okay. I could feel him smile.
-I’m gonna miss you so fucking much, you know that? I was rapidly blinking to keep my eyes from watering. It didn't work.
-Oh, I know, and I’ll miss you even more.
-I strongly doubt that. I laughed a little. My voice was turning thick. Fuck.
-Bye, Gerard.
I pulled away, watching his sad face smile a last time before he turned around with my mom and dad and walked out of the office, Mr. Oswald showing them out. I saw my brother turn around and he gave me a small wave before he disappeared. I waved back, watching him go, raising my arm halfway, just slightly moving my fingers.
-Bye, Mikes, I whispered. Kenzie laid a hand on my back. I wiped away the tear that escaped my glassy eyes.
